diff --git a/fluentui-ard/Entropy/AppCheckerResult.sarif b/fluentui-ard/Entropy/AppCheckerResult.sarif
index daca6004181a33102fb38a46f481fb0dbe9ea0e8..7e4b1c144766e39af1070b432b89c3516682f5e1 100644
--- a/fluentui-ard/Entropy/AppCheckerResult.sarif
+++ b/fluentui-ard/Entropy/AppCheckerResult.sarif
@@ -98,36 +98,6 @@
"ruleId": "acc-FocusBorderShouldBeVisible",
"ruleIndex": 2
},
- {
- "locations": [
- {
- "logicalLocations": [
- {
- "fullyQualifiedName": "Screen1.ConFkt1.Eraser1.AccessibleLabel"
- }
- ],
- "physicalLocation": {
- "address": {
- "fullyQualifiedName": "Screen1.ConFkt1.Eraser1.AccessibleLabel",
- "relativeAddress": 0
- }
- },
- "properties": {
- "member": "AccessibleLabel",
- "module": "Screen1",
- "type": "Screen1.ConFkt1.Eraser1"
- }
- }
- ],
- "message": {
- "id": "issue"
- },
- "properties": {
- "level": "Medium"
- },
- "ruleId": "acc-AccessibleLabelNeeded",
- "ruleIndex": 3
- },
{
"locations": [
{
@@ -156,7 +126,7 @@
"level": "Low"
},
"ruleId": "acc-TabOrderShouldBeChecked",
- "ruleIndex": 4
+ "ruleIndex": 3
},
{
"locations": [
@@ -216,37 +186,7 @@
"level": "Medium"
},
"ruleId": "acc-HelpfulControlSettingNeeded",
- "ruleIndex": 5
- },
- {
- "locations": [
- {
- "logicalLocations": [
- {
- "fullyQualifiedName": "Screen1.ConFkt1.Creativity1.AccessibleLabel"
- }
- ],
- "physicalLocation": {
- "address": {
- "fullyQualifiedName": "Screen1.ConFkt1.Creativity1.AccessibleLabel",
- "relativeAddress": 0
- }
- },
- "properties": {
- "member": "AccessibleLabel",
- "module": "Screen1",
- "type": "Screen1.ConFkt1.Creativity1"
- }
- }
- ],
- "message": {
- "id": "issue"
- },
- "properties": {
- "level": "Medium"
- },
- "ruleId": "acc-AccessibleLabelNeeded",
- "ruleIndex": 3
+ "ruleIndex": 4
},
{
"locations": [
@@ -276,36 +216,6 @@
"level": "Low"
},
"ruleId": "acc-TabOrderShouldBeChecked",
- "ruleIndex": 4
- },
- {
- "locations": [
- {
- "logicalLocations": [
- {
- "fullyQualifiedName": "Screen1.ConSend.textinput1.AccessibleLabel"
- }
- ],
- "physicalLocation": {
- "address": {
- "fullyQualifiedName": "Screen1.ConSend.textinput1.AccessibleLabel",
- "relativeAddress": 0
- }
- },
- "properties": {
- "member": "AccessibleLabel",
- "module": "Screen1",
- "type": "Screen1.ConSend.textinput1"
- }
- }
- ],
- "message": {
- "id": "issue"
- },
- "properties": {
- "level": "Medium"
- },
- "ruleId": "acc-AccessibleLabelNeeded",
"ruleIndex": 3
},
{
@@ -336,7 +246,7 @@
"level": "Low"
},
"ruleId": "acc-TabOrderShouldBeChecked",
- "ruleIndex": 4
+ "ruleIndex": 3
},
{
"locations": [
@@ -366,7 +276,7 @@
"level": "Medium"
},
"ruleId": "app-UnusedMediaResources",
- "ruleIndex": 6
+ "ruleIndex": 5
}
],
"tool": {
@@ -425,23 +335,6 @@
"whyFix": "If the focus isn't visible, people who don't use a mouse won't be able to see it when they're interacting with the app."
}
},
- {
- "id": "acc-AccessibleLabelNeeded",
- "messageStrings": {
- "issue": {
- "text": "Missing accessible label"
- }
- },
- "properties": {
- "componentType": "app",
- "howToFix": [
- "Edit the accessible label property to describe the item."
- ],
- "level": "Medium",
- "primaryCategory": "accessibility",
- "whyFix": "If there's no accessible text, people who can’t see the screen won't understand what’s in images and controls."
- }
- },
{
"id": "acc-TabOrderShouldBeChecked",
"messageStrings": {
diff --git a/fluentui-ard/Entropy/Entropy.json b/fluentui-ard/Entropy/Entropy.json
index 64a5c2695c6bc2b8e4b7a42c30316a444687cd71..0b4b36ee0d82904de5c2b825386b1400b38fd9a0 100644
--- a/fluentui-ard/Entropy/Entropy.json
+++ b/fluentui-ard/Entropy/Entropy.json
@@ -26,7 +26,7 @@
"DoesTestStepsMetadataExist": true,
"FunctionParamsInvariantScripts": {},
"FunctionParamsInvariantScriptsOnInstances": {},
- "HeaderLastSavedDateTimeUTC": "01/18/2024 10:14:15",
+ "HeaderLastSavedDateTimeUTC": "01/18/2024 10:22:42",
"IsLegacyComponentAllowGlobalScopeCase": false,
"LocalConnectionIDReferences": {
"3949869c-0bc9-4a51-90cd-bf1287c9e326": "\"/providers/microsoft.powerapps/apis/shared_azure-2dopenai-2dconnector-5f1d98e22a441b0e2d-5f3739fab3a930da50/connections/shared-azure-2dopena-3f4cdc89-63b5-4018-882d-1f1c97eb18e0\"",
diff --git a/fluentui-ard/Entropy/checksum.json b/fluentui-ard/Entropy/checksum.json
index 998feae481b500863db22e8631242f8c654f07aa..cd4ebe25cbceaf14653ccdbbc4be58e6e7b9e9ba 100644
--- a/fluentui-ard/Entropy/checksum.json
+++ b/fluentui-ard/Entropy/checksum.json
@@ -4,13 +4,13 @@
"IsLocalBuild": false
},
"ClientPerFileChecksums": {
- "AppCheckerResult.sarif": "C8_/9BWjPVW3+/ezylyR5SQ7uoCFXvUHk3ZOnwPmzpDJAc=",
+ "AppCheckerResult.sarif": "C8_7d20kcSQNRogaEaT7/StMdAmGlZXdoRcLFN7aoMVoc4=",
"AppTests\\2.json": "C8_omA4KVA0ye8qkU+fMWC8nSkoW42AEHM4XBnnYkUJCys=",
"Assets\\Images\\0001.png": "C8_D0WGiAaxVuIcUWpkdQuVcyQy/gSJZuMRDwL63zxJhAk=",
"Assets\\Images\\0002.jpg": "C8_Tc/HGdQ62xbtBm/41G1l7DIpMm/RT0cgmhtJyanyURs=",
"Controls\\1.json": "C8_/PwNEU6dV00x9Xr4Yt93zX1EmsxAh36PVgOdFy9WD8g=",
- "Controls\\4.json": "C8_hgKPIJfA3aaS7dgZgzEeqeCW+RJMb8kznfzSunKNiUY=",
- "Header.json": "C8_Av0Y2bn5bKf1pp67Tlk/1bedfG/MISxtFNaZOwx7kpY=",
+ "Controls\\4.json": "C8_7BRjimXjyz/w8JkCBjFLzuT1fPNYYjFOgct7xGxvO7g=",
+ "Header.json": "C8_zrZZsDBijLLbF7UAsGcT+hiQy8dW4702RKEYGXYq/Mg=",
"Properties.json": "C8_nxOQl8+H0SuSObmKOoy458WWCGELjfT4AhQWfpMr4bQ=",
"References\\DataSources.json": "C8_khu+WUDb4a5tvZu/0zvUqAExTFpdTX7df3InxUaD7RQ=",
"References\\ModernThemes.json": "C8_KDQJ/3t27vgKx25iCQB/PGqxkWE34ZB7Eyb+RxNxY0k=",
@@ -19,15 +19,15 @@
"References\\Themes.json": "C8_zuMgLpz3IJQlVgGqo3GtyhriL3PR35GxXf+rtPR4Gfc=",
"Resources\\PublishInfo.json": "C8_L9UhOWDoS/LUj0KodcbQiXLqewg00O5iSZA4+bCdTGs="
},
- "ClientStampedChecksum": "C8_kN6ySmX1/vd2Gp3lK3m7Xn7HQ1hX5nkxLM7S8adJCFE=",
+ "ClientStampedChecksum": "C8_acRBxoxj6ZkOc1FhGcg9NCkpk+jEG0I9B0agtp/vT68=",
"ServerPerFileChecksums": {
- "AppCheckerResult.sarif": "C8_/9BWjPVW3+/ezylyR5SQ7uoCFXvUHk3ZOnwPmzpDJAc=",
+ "AppCheckerResult.sarif": "C8_7d20kcSQNRogaEaT7/StMdAmGlZXdoRcLFN7aoMVoc4=",
"AppTests\\2.json": "C8_omA4KVA0ye8qkU+fMWC8nSkoW42AEHM4XBnnYkUJCys=",
"Assets\\Images\\0001.png": "C8_D0WGiAaxVuIcUWpkdQuVcyQy/gSJZuMRDwL63zxJhAk=",
"Assets\\Images\\0002.jpg": "C8_Tc/HGdQ62xbtBm/41G1l7DIpMm/RT0cgmhtJyanyURs=",
"Controls\\1.json": "C8_/PwNEU6dV00x9Xr4Yt93zX1EmsxAh36PVgOdFy9WD8g=",
- "Controls\\4.json": "C8_hgKPIJfA3aaS7dgZgzEeqeCW+RJMb8kznfzSunKNiUY=",
- "Header.json": "C8_Av0Y2bn5bKf1pp67Tlk/1bedfG/MISxtFNaZOwx7kpY=",
+ "Controls\\4.json": "C8_7BRjimXjyz/w8JkCBjFLzuT1fPNYYjFOgct7xGxvO7g=",
+ "Header.json": "C8_zrZZsDBijLLbF7UAsGcT+hiQy8dW4702RKEYGXYq/Mg=",
"Properties.json": "C8_nxOQl8+H0SuSObmKOoy458WWCGELjfT4AhQWfpMr4bQ=",
"References\\DataSources.json": "C8_khu+WUDb4a5tvZu/0zvUqAExTFpdTX7df3InxUaD7RQ=",
"References\\ModernThemes.json": "C8_KDQJ/3t27vgKx25iCQB/PGqxkWE34ZB7Eyb+RxNxY0k=",
@@ -36,5 +36,5 @@
"References\\Themes.json": "C8_zuMgLpz3IJQlVgGqo3GtyhriL3PR35GxXf+rtPR4Gfc=",
"Resources\\PublishInfo.json": "C8_L9UhOWDoS/LUj0KodcbQiXLqewg00O5iSZA4+bCdTGs="
},
- "ServerStampedChecksum": "C8_kN6ySmX1/vd2Gp3lK3m7Xn7HQ1hX5nkxLM7S8adJCFE="
+ "ServerStampedChecksum": "C8_acRBxoxj6ZkOc1FhGcg9NCkpk+jEG0I9B0agtp/vT68="
}
\ No newline at end of file
diff --git a/fluentui-ard/Src/EditorState/Screen1.editorstate.json b/fluentui-ard/Src/EditorState/Screen1.editorstate.json
index 0d3ed202fe7a5d30072adef18c3a3cc2a6bac608..3b5652bb66f208482d0b8009377d402911425e84 100644
--- a/fluentui-ard/Src/EditorState/Screen1.editorstate.json
+++ b/fluentui-ard/Src/EditorState/Screen1.editorstate.json
@@ -1946,7 +1946,14 @@
"IsLockable": false,
"NameMapSourceSchema": "?"
},
- "AccessibleLabel",
+ {
+ "AFDDataSourceName": "",
+ "AutoRuleBindingEnabled": false,
+ "AutoRuleBindingString": "\"\"",
+ "InvariantPropertyName": "AccessibleLabel",
+ "IsLockable": false,
+ "NameMapSourceSchema": "?"
+ },
"ContentLanguage",
{
"AFDDataSourceName": "",
@@ -2378,6 +2385,14 @@
"InvariantPropertyName": "TabIndex",
"IsLockable": false,
"NameMapSourceSchema": "?"
+ },
+ {
+ "AFDDataSourceName": "",
+ "AutoRuleBindingEnabled": false,
+ "AutoRuleBindingString": "\"\"",
+ "InvariantPropertyName": "AccessibleLabel",
+ "IsLockable": false,
+ "NameMapSourceSchema": "?"
}
],
"HasDynamicProperties": false,
@@ -2394,6 +2409,11 @@
"ParentIndex": 2,
"PersistMetaDataIDKey": false,
"Properties": [
+ {
+ "Category": "Data",
+ "PropertyName": "AccessibleLabel",
+ "RuleProviderType": "Unknown"
+ },
{
"Category": "Design",
"PropertyName": "Color",
@@ -2927,7 +2947,15 @@
"PaddingTop",
"PaddingRight",
"PaddingBottom",
- "PaddingLeft"
+ "PaddingLeft",
+ {
+ "AFDDataSourceName": "",
+ "AutoRuleBindingEnabled": false,
+ "AutoRuleBindingString": "\"\"",
+ "InvariantPropertyName": "AccessibleLabel",
+ "IsLockable": false,
+ "NameMapSourceSchema": "?"
+ }
],
"HasDynamicProperties": false,
"IsAutoGenerated": false,
@@ -2948,6 +2976,11 @@
"PropertyName": "Image",
"RuleProviderType": "Unknown"
},
+ {
+ "Category": "Data",
+ "PropertyName": "AccessibleLabel",
+ "RuleProviderType": "Unknown"
+ },
{
"Category": "Design",
"PropertyName": "BorderThickness",
@@ -3959,6 +3992,14 @@
"InvariantPropertyName": "MaxLength",
"IsLockable": false,
"NameMapSourceSchema": "?"
+ },
+ {
+ "AFDDataSourceName": "",
+ "AutoRuleBindingEnabled": false,
+ "AutoRuleBindingString": "\"\"",
+ "InvariantPropertyName": "AccessibleLabel",
+ "IsLockable": false,
+ "NameMapSourceSchema": "?"
}
],
"HasDynamicProperties": false,
@@ -3995,6 +4036,11 @@
"PropertyName": "MaxLength",
"RuleProviderType": "Unknown"
},
+ {
+ "Category": "Data",
+ "PropertyName": "AccessibleLabel",
+ "RuleProviderType": "Unknown"
+ },
{
"Category": "Design",
"PropertyName": "Mode",
diff --git a/fluentui-ard/Src/Screen1.fx.yaml b/fluentui-ard/Src/Screen1.fx.yaml
index 97ac55dc17213edc24e5df73f3896e20941129c9..ceaa75c53bc17a4f1bb036ad1863e9dc0e685a66 100644
--- a/fluentui-ard/Src/Screen1.fx.yaml
+++ b/fluentui-ard/Src/Screen1.fx.yaml
@@ -32,6 +32,7 @@ Screen1 As screen:
ZIndex: =1
Logo As image:
+ AccessibleLabel: ="ARD Logo"
Height: =ConBan.Height - (ConBan.Height/6)
Image: ='ard-logo'
Width: =ConBan.Width/3.5
@@ -48,6 +49,7 @@ Screen1 As screen:
ZIndex: =2
Creativity1 As toggleSwitch:
+ AccessibleLabel: ="Kreativitätsmodus aktivieren oder deaktivieren"
BorderColor: =RGBA(0, 52, 128, 1)
Color: =RGBA(255, 255, 255, 1)
DisabledBorderColor: =RGBA(0, 52, 128, 1)
@@ -98,6 +100,7 @@ Screen1 As screen:
ZIndex: =2
Eraser1 As icon.Erase:
+ AccessibleLabel: ="Lösche deine Konversation mit dem Assistenten"
BorderColor: =RGBA(0, 0, 0, 0)
Color: =RGBA(255, 255, 255, 1)
DisabledBorderColor: =RGBA(245, 245, 245, 1)
@@ -123,7 +126,7 @@ Screen1 As screen:
ZIndex: =3
SendMail1 As icon.Mail:
- AccessibleLabel: ="ALSendMail1"
+ AccessibleLabel: ="Sende deine Konversation mit dem Assistenten an deinen E-mail Account"
BorderColor: =RGBA(0, 0, 0, 0)
Color: =RGBA(255, 255, 255, 1)
DisabledBorderColor: =RGBA(245, 245, 245, 1)
@@ -168,7 +171,7 @@ Screen1 As screen:
ZIndex: =1
chatbox1 As text:
- AccessibleLabel: ="ALchatbox1"
+ AccessibleLabel: ="Deine Konversation mit dem Assistenten"
BorderColor: =RGBA(224, 24, 24, 1)
BorderThickness: =0
Default: =varResp
@@ -208,6 +211,7 @@ Screen1 As screen:
ZIndex: =4
textinput1 As text:
+ AccessibleLabel: ="Hier kannst du deine Frage schreiben"
BorderColor: =RGBA(224, 24, 24, 1)
BorderThickness: =0
Default: =""
@@ -240,7 +244,7 @@ Screen1 As screen:
ZIndex: =1
send1 As icon.Send:
- AccessibleLabel: ="Send Question"
+ AccessibleLabel: ="Sende deine Frage"
AutoDisableOnSelect: =
BorderColor: =RGBA(0, 0, 0, 0)
Color: =RGBA(255, 255, 255, 1)